The protein encoded by this gene is involved in the conversion of tyrosine to dopamine. It is the rate-limiting enzyme in the synthesis of catecholamines, hence plays a key role in the physiology of adrenergic neurons. L-DOPA is a metabolic precursor of dopamine that is capable of crossing the blood-brain barrier. It is produced from L-tyrosine by tyrosine hydroxylase and metabolized by catechol-O-methyl transferase (COMT). In the brain L-DOPA is converted to dopamine. Metyrosine is an inhibitor of tyrosine hydroxylase. In vivo, metyrosine (200 mg/kg) reduces norepinephrine and dopamine levels in rat brain and disrupts conditioned avoidance behavior in a dose-dependent manner.
